PULLMAN, Wash. – Following is a list of performances to be offered by the Washington State University School of Music, Nov. 28-Dec. 3.
- Tuesday, Nov. 28 – Brass Chamber Music and Student Chamber Music, 8 p.m., Bryan Hall Theatre. Free admission.
- Wednesday, Nov. 29 – Symphonic Wind Ensemble and Symphonic Band, 8 p.m., Bryan Hall Theatre. Free admission.
- Thursday, Nov. 30 – Student Recital: Garrett Snedeker, piano, 8 p.m., Kimbrough Concert Hall. Free admission.
- Saturday, Dec. 2 – Holiday Concert, 2 p.m., Bryan Hall Theatre. Tickets will be on sale at the door beginning 45 minutes before the concert. Prices are $15 general admission, $10 students and senior citizens, and free for children 12 and under.
- Sunday, Dec. 3 – Piano Pedagogy Lab School Recitals, 1 p.m., Kimbrough Concert Hall. Free admission.
